Dr. Kaitlyn Howden completed medical school at McMaster Waterloo Regional Campus and did her general pediatrics residency in Winnipeg through the University of Manitoba. She is currently in her final year of the Hematology-Oncology Fellowship at McMaster University, and along the way has fallen in love with the field of pediatric neuro-oncology. Her current research interests are focused on gaining insights into the treatment experiences of pediatric neuro-oncology patients and their families, with the ultimate goal of determining how patient and parent engagement can shape future research and clinical tools for this unique population.
In this week's core session of Grand Rounds, Dr. Howden discusses the rapidly expanding world of neuro-oncology treatment in the age of molecular medicine and how to consider having family preferences better represented through patient engagement in research.
